      I don't recommend sticking your thumb in your ear, like this video shows. You can create extreme pressurization in the ear canal, and that could lead to a dangerous condition for your ear drum.

      If you end up with something plugging your ear (like ear plugs or just your finger), extreme care should be taken when taking it out. You don't want a plunger effect on your ear drum.
